- Product Strategy & Vision: Define and champion the product vision, strategy, and roadmap for all applications and platforms utilized by Richemont's CRCs, aligning with overall business objectives and client experience goals and omni-channel needs.
- Leadership & Oversight: Act as a leader, overseeing and guiding product teams responsible for the development and continuous improvement of CRC-facing products.
- Provide mentorship and strategic direction to ensure consistent product excellence.
- Stakeholder Management: Collaborate extensively with CRC operations, Group Technology and Maisons responsible teams.
- Manage as well external vendors to gather requirements, orchestrate expectations, and ensure product solutions meet diverse business needs.
- Product Lifecycle mindset: Own the end-to-end product lifecycle, from discovery, ideation, and requirements gathering to development, launch, adoption, and post-launch optimization.
- Roadmap & Backlog Management: Develop and maintain a clear, prioritized product roadmap and backlog, ensuring features deliver maximum business value, enhance agent efficiency, and improve the overall client journey.
- Technology Expertise: Drive the strategic adoption and optimization of key technologies within the CRC ecosystem, with a strong focus on Salesforce (particularly Service Cloud) and integrated telephony solutions.

Do I need a cross-border work permit for a role in Geneva?
EU/EFTA residents living in the border zone of the country adjoining Canton Geneva can apply for a G permit; the Swiss employer files it with that canton's migration office after the contract is signed. Border-zone rules and processing times vary by neighbouring country and canton, so confirm the specifics with Geneva's cantonal migration office or with HR during the application.
